What separates a solid proposition from a weak one
Most quotes include panel count, approximated production, tools brand, and a complete cost. That is a beginning, not a full analysis. Strong solar providers clarify why the system is developed the way it is.
A beneficial proposal need to show projected yearly manufacturing in kilowatt-hours, not simply the system size in kilowatts. Those are related, however not the exact same. A 7 kW system on one roof covering might outshine an 8 kW system on one more if roofing system positioning and shading are better. The proposal must additionally recognize presumptions around sunlight exposure, destruction gradually, and energy rate acceleration if cost savings estimates are included.
Pay focus to design reasoning. Are panels being pushed onto shaded roofing system areas simply to maximize the system size? Is the installer recommending premium modules when conventional top quality panels would likely do equally as well on your home? Is there a battery included due to the fact that you need durability, or due to the fact that it raises the contract value?
The best solar companies can describe compromises in ordinary language. As an example, microinverters can be a smart choice on roofing systems with partial shade or several roofing airplanes. String inverters can be effective and affordable on easier roofing systems with constant sun direct exposure. Neither choice is globally "ideal." What issues is whether the recommendation fits your home.
Price per watt informs you more than the heading number
Solar prices can be complex because 2 systems with various sizes and tools blends can have very different overalls. Among the simplest means to contrast propositions is cost per watt, calculated by separating the system expense by the system dimension in watts. That provides you a better apples-to-apples measure than total contract price alone.
Still, price per watt has restrictions. It does not catch distinctions in panel quality, inverter style, roof covering intricacy, service warranty coverage, or service responsiveness. A lower number is not constantly a much better worth if the installer cut corners on style, labor, or post-install support.
I have actually seen house owners save a couple of thousand bucks in advance just to face extensive downtime since their installer had poor solution ability and no local technician schedule. On paper, that lower quote "won." Over the life of the system, it did not.
If one proposition is considerably cheaper than the others, ask why. Sometimes the reason is legitimate, such as a company with reduced expenses or a short-lived tools promotion. Often it reflects weaker workmanship requirements, hostile presumptions regarding power production, or concealed prices that show up later on in change orders and exclusions.
Financing transforms the actual cost of solar
A money purchase, a solar loan, and a lease or power purchase agreement can all make good sense in different situations, but they are not interchangeable. The best solar providers will walk through the real economics without glossing over the downsides.
A cash money purchase typically offers the greatest long-term return if you can manage it. You avoid loan interest and maintain the amount of the power savings. A funding decreases the initial obstacle and can still work well, especially if the monthly repayment is much less than your typical utility costs. But you require to look carefully at dealer fees, rates of interest, early repayment terms, and whether predicted financial savings depend on optimistic utility price increases.
Leases and power acquisition arrangements can attract property owners that want little or no upfront price and choose a less complex plan. The trade-off is that you may give up several of the long-lasting monetary benefit, and marketing your home can come to be extra difficult if the buyer should think the agreement.
Good solar companies do not deal with financing as a side note. They describe just how each structure influences ownership, rewards, transferability, and payback. If the sales representative maintains steering the conversation back to "month-to-month savings" without revealing the complete contract business economics, slow-moving down.
Equipment high quality is important, however installer quality is normally more important
Homeowners commonly spend a lot of power contrasting panel brands, which is reasonable. Panels are the most noticeable part of the system. Actually, the installer often has more impact on your experience than the logo on the module.
Most developed producers currently generate trustworthy panels with long performance guarantees. The bigger inquiries are whether the installer utilizes proper flashing and installing hardware, whether electrical wiring is neat and code-compliant, whether the roofing infiltrations are managed effectively, and whether the carrier will support guarantee cases if an element stops working years later.
That said, tools still matters. Seek a supplier that can explain the distinction between product warranty and efficiency guarantee, in addition to labor guarantee insurance coverage from the installer. A 25-year manufacturer warranty appears reassuring, however it does not always cover the labor to diagnose, remove, and replace unsuccessful devices. That is where a solid handiwork warranty becomes valuable.
Ask how the business manages inverter replacement, checking problems, and roofing leak issues. You are not looking for an excellent pledge. You are trying to find a clear process.

Roof condition and electrical preparedness can make or damage the project
One of the most expensive mistakes house owners make is mounting solar on a roof that might need substitute in a few years. If your roofing system is nearing the end of its life, handle that very first or coordinate roof and solar with each other. Eliminating and re-installing panels later adds expense and hassle that typically outweigh any type of short-term gain from moving quickly.
Your electric system matters as well. Older homes often require a main circuit box upgrade before solar can be interconnected safely and legally. A good installer will determine this early. It is better to find out that before finalizing than midway through permitting.
This is where the best solar panel providers distinguish themselves. They assess the whole site, not simply the bright sections of the roof. Often the most helpful answer a homeowner can hear is, "Solar makes sense, yet not up until you address these two issues initially."
Batteries are not always necessary, but often they are the appropriate call
Many home owners now inquire about battery storage space throughout first assessments. The interest is easy to understand. Batteries can offer backup power, help take care https://www.google.com/maps/place/?q=place_id:ChIJXYtShUXzj4AR1a0CM4L5Wec of time-of-use prices in some utility regions, and add strength throughout outages.
They likewise add substantial cost. For some houses, particularly those mostly focused on reducing bills, a battery may not pencil out yet. For others, such as households with constant interruptions, medical devices, remote work requirements, or a wish to keep refrigeration and essential circuits running, the value is much more functional than simply financial.
A provider who automatically includes batteries in every proposal is not always acting in your benefit. The far better strategy is scenario-based. What loads do you desire backed up? How much time do interruptions normally last? Are you trying to cover the whole house, or basics? Those details form whether a battery makes good sense and just how huge it need to be.

Do solar panels work in winter in Danville?
Yes, solar panels continue generating electricity during winter as long as they receive sunlight. Production levels are typically lower because winter days are shorter and the sun's angle is lower. Cooler temperatures can actually improve solar panel efficiency. Overall output depends on weather conditions and available sunlight.
